Default violent idle ?

i recently missed a gear and redlined really hard. . .and now my car idles like crap. . it idles really hard like its about to stall, but above 2500 rpm everything is normal, and i dont notice any loss of power except from idle to 2500 it hesitatea a little. any oppinions of what is causing it to idle like that?

Default Re: violent idle ? (ReBornGSR)

If you bent a valve or valves due to an over-rev you probably bent a rod aswell.Pull the plugs and check them for anything strange.Especially any oil fouling.It will be cylinder #3 more than likely.More than likely this will be a pretty expensive mistake.
